Output 50986e01726e33c5ffa0088494aaf512eccebcbf8cf08599bf7e41f144a8ca86:0

value
623434
script pubkey
OP_0 OP_PUSHBYTES_20 1d937f24e51c1ab1ad04d1559ace6f881acbf4f8
address
bc1qrkfh7f89rsdtrtgy692e4nn03qdvha8ce528z7
transaction
50986e01726e33c5ffa0088494aaf512eccebcbf8cf08599bf7e41f144a8ca86
spent
true